24 die of rabies in Bulacan | The Manila Times

A TOTAL of 23,013 cases of rabies and 24 deaths were recorded in Bulacan in 2023, the Bulacan Provincial Health Office (PHO) reported.Based on the 2023 Rabies Prevention and Control Program Accomplishment Report of the PHO-Public Health, animal bite cases in Bulacan increased by 4 percent in the year 2023 with 53,013 cases compared to 50,809 cases in 2022 from the 3.8 million population in the province. ....

rabies: World Rabies Day 2023: Date, significance, history and theme; everything you need to know about the day

World Rabies Day, organized by the Global Alliance for Rabies Control, is celebrated on September 28 each year to raise awareness and advocate for the global elimination of rabies. The day commemorates French scientist Louis Pasteur, whose work led to the development of the rabies vaccine. The main objectives of World Rabies Day are to raise awareness, promote vaccination, advocate for control measures, and celebrate milestones in the fight against rabies. This year s theme emphasizes the need for a collaborative and multidisciplinary approach to combat the disease. ....
